### Description This PR: (1) Fixes AMD builds after #17200 broke them (Need to remember to run AMD builds while trying to merge external CUDA PRs next time) (2) Turn on the NHWC CUDA feature in the Linux GPU CI. The extra time spent in building a few more files and running a few more tests will not be much. Test Linux GPU CI run : https://dev.azure.com/onnxruntime/onnxruntime/_build/results?buildId=1170770 ### Motivation and Context Keep the NHWC CUDA ops tested (https://github.com/microsoft/onnxruntime/pull/17200) and guard against regressions
